  4. To me Dino comes off as the ultimate Corpo poser. Every other Fixer no matter how morally grey are "honest" in the way they portray themselves. Regina is a fundamentally good person who is doing her best to not fall into amorality. Wakako is an amoral, machiavellian crimelord but she never pretends to be anything but that and it actually makes her fairly easy and "fair" to deal with. El Capitan is an opportunistic rogue but has a clear moral center, and Padre will never lie to you about how much he has to strike a balance between ruthlessness and morality at any given time. It's only Dino who has a completely fake persona and manner, who leads a life and acts in ways at odds with his image. I guess that makes him the least "punk" out of all of em.
